Inclusion criteria

Inclusion criteria: 1. Patients with chronic HF under stable clinical condition. 2. Aged over 20. 3. Can follow instructions without mental illness or hearing impairment.

Exclusion criteria

Exclusion criteria: 1. Have resistance training within the past six months. 2. Unable to perform squats due to degenerative joint arthritis. 3. Walk less than 30 minutes daily. 4. Have a history of venous thrombosis. 5. Peripheral neuropathy. 6. Severe peripheral arterial disease. 7. Impaired kidney function. 8. Severe hypertension. 9. Under dual antiplatelet therapy.

Design outcomes

Primary

MeasureTime frame
Exercise capacity Before and after intervention Cardiopulmonary exercise capacity, six minute walk test, chair stand test, timed up-and-go test,Muscle strength Before and after intervention 10 repetition maximum

Secondary

MeasureTime frame
Cardiac function Before and after intervention blood draw, Responses of local muscles Before and after intervention Electromyography, and near-infrared spectroscopy,Mitochondrial function in skeletal muscles Before and after intervention Near-infrared spectroscopy,Vascular function Before and after intervention Pulse wave velocity, Dietary diversity score Before and after intervention Dietary recall or record, Physical activity Before and after intervention Questionnaire,Quality of life Before and after intervention Questionnaire
